About Paper Reports

Each student is expected to write a short report about the papers presented. The contents of this report should include the following:
  • Problem definition: One-two sentences explaining the problem attacked
  • Main contribution(s): Main contributions of the paper
  • Advantage(s): Main advantages of the proposed method or things you like about the paper
  • Disadvantage(s): Main disadvantages of the proposed method or things you don't like about the paper
Each report:
  • should be half-page long at most.
  • can be written either in Turkish/English.
  • is due beginning of the class of the presentation time.
  • should be sent by email. It should be in .pdf format and the subject of the email should include "Bil682-PaperReport" phrase. Otherwise your report may be unseen and discarded.
Important Note: In order to receive participation credit (10%), each student must provide at least 5 paper reports. No credit will be given if less than 5 paper reports are submitted.
